Job Description

Automation Design Engineer

Vantage Data Centers

• Collaborate with Design, Engineering, Construction, Reliability Engineering, Site Operations, and Automation Engineering team members to implement and sustain automation solutions • Support troubleshooting and resolution of automation system issues under guidance of senior engineers • Develop automation logic and visualization applications based on project documentation including drawings, sequences of operation, bills of material, and instrumentation diagrams • Review mechanical/electrical drawings, P&IDs, and sequences of operation to translate requirements into automation logic • Support new system installations as well as upgrades to existing, live mission-critical environments • Assist with system commissioning, startup, and validation to ensure proper functionality and performance • Collaborate with multidisciplinary teams including mechanical, electrical, and operations stakeholders • Create and maintain detailed technical documentation, including design packages, programming standards, and test procedures • Implement reusable logic and standardized automation components as defined by the team • Provide technical support and guidance to field technicians and operations teams • Additional duties as assigned by Management

Job Requirements

  • Working knowledge of the Ignition (Inductive Automation) SCADA platform
  • Three to five years of experience in industrial automation SCADA development
  • Data center experience preferred but not required
  • Understanding of automation systems including control loops, field I/O, and industrial control system fundamentals
  • Experience with industrial PLC platforms, including Rockwell Automation, Carel, or similar systems
  • Familiarity with version control systems and software development best practices preferred
  • Demonstrated ability to work collaboratively across teams and follow defined technical standards
  • Proficiency with Microsoft Office and SharePoint
  • Bachelor's degree in Electrical Engineering, Mechatronics, Automation Engineering, or a related field (or equivalent hands-on experience)
  • 3+ years of experience in industrial automation, controls engineering, or a similar role
  • Proficiency in AutoCAD for electrical design, including control panel layouts and schematics
  • Hands-on experience with Rockwell / Allen-Bradley PLC programming (Studio 5000, RSLogix 500/5000)
  • Experience developing HMI/SCADA systems (Ignition preferred)
  • Strong understanding of electrical systems, control panels, instrumentation, and industrial automation components
  • Ability to read and interpret electrical drawings, P&IDs, and sequences of operation
  • Familiarity with industrial communication protocols (EtherNet/IP, Modbus, etc.)
  • Experience supporting commissioning, startup, and troubleshooting in live or mission-critical environments
  • Knowledge of applicable codes and standards (NFPA, UL, NEC, etc.)
  • Strong analytical, troubleshooting, and problem-solving skills
  • Ability to manage multiple tasks and priorities in a fast-paced environment
  • Effective communication skills and ability to collaborate across cross-functional teams
  • Travel required up to approximately 25%, with potential variation based on business needs
